D-Link’s Intelligent QoS Technology - WHY INTELLIGENT QoS IS BETTER
With some routers, all wired and wireless traffic, including VoIP, Video Streaming, Online Gaming, and Web browsing are mixed together into a single data stream. By handling data this way, applications like video streaming could pause or delay. With D-Link’s Intelligent QoS Technology, wired and wireless traffic is analyzed and separated into multiple data streams. These streams are then categorized by sensitivity to delay, so applications like VoIP, Video Streaming, and Online Gaming are given priority over Web browsing. This enables multiple applications to stream smoothly to your TV or PC.

ADVANCED NETWORK SECURITY

The Xtreme N Gigabit Router supports the latest wireless security features to help prevent unauthorized access, be it from over a wireless network or from the Internet. Support for WEP™, WPA™, and WPA2™ standards ensure that you will be able to use the best possible encryption regardless of your client devices. In addition, this Xtreme N router utilizes Dual Active Firewalls (SPI and NAT) to prevent potential attacks from across the Internet.

     Rated by Richard_V, July 13, 2009

    Alright here's my experience with this router. I plugged it in and setup my basic home network on this router which consists of 2 wireless connections, 2 wired connections and a usb printer. Out of the box and while it still worked I noticed a new firmware update. I proceeded to flash the device and everything was fine. My wife noticed the wireless laptop was having connection issues which I figured may have been the qos setting in the router and nothing more. I went to work and low and behold the router started rebooting by itself and all light flashing on the router... well more like flickering. I attempted to get into the web based interface with no luck at all as the router was rebooting every 30sec or locking up and needing a hard power-off (reboot/reset). In any event it took less than 48 hours for this router to die in an air conditioned room. I've read other peoples reviews on this model and the revision doesn't seem to matter. Mine was an A4 revision. When the thing worked it worked great for wired and I'm sure the wireless would also be great give more configuring with the router. My experience with routers and IT is extensive as that's was I do in the military. This router it highly rated for the ones that work... My only grip will be the high rate of "lemon's" dlink has put out for this model. I have always liked dlink routers and I hope the RMA I get doesn't disappoint... if it does then i'll go with the dlink825. Buyer beware with this router. I would not suggest this unit to anyone who has limited router knowledge due to the fact of it needing to be "proven". Also the usb port on the router requires software on the connecting devices in order to utilize the device on the usb port. I though this fact was unfortunate and will likely stick with my print "server" unit. If you look on dlink's website there are many technical support posts in the companies forums related to this router. Basically, if you get one that isn't defective it will work great. I'm giving this product 2/5 stars because of my experience... if it worked better and I didn't have to ship the thing back out of my wallet for the rma that would be better. (That was with the extra shipping insurance btw)       » READ MORE
